The hexadecimal color code #EFAAB5 corresponds to the code RGB( 239, 170, 181 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,94 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,71 level). Its brightness is 80% and its saturation is 68%. It is composed of red at 40%, green at 28% and blue at 30%.

Uses of #EFAAB5 in CSS

When using #EFAAB5 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#EFAAB5 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
